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
L
luqiao-app
Overview
Overview
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
杨子
luqiao-app
Commits
9a546064
Commit
9a546064
authored
Jun 04, 2019
by
niuxiaolin
Browse files
Options
Browse Files
Download
Plain Diff
mrege
parents
a5b655ff
b6e79db9
Hide whitespace changes
Inline
Side-by-side
Showing
16 changed files
with
69 additions
and
56 deletions
+69
-56
config.xml
config.xml
+1
-1
proxy.config.json
proxy.config.json
+1
-1
assets.component.ts
src/app/layout/default/assets/assets.component.ts
+5
-5
check.component.html
src/app/layout/default/check/check.component.html
+2
-1
user.component.html
src/app/layout/default/user/user.component.html
+3
-2
user.component.ts
src/app/layout/default/user/user.component.ts
+3
-0
passport.component.html
src/app/layout/passport/passport.component.html
+1
-1
passport.component.less
src/app/layout/passport/passport.component.less
+1
-3
assets-list.component.html
...ets-used/checkPlan/assets-list/assets-list.component.html
+10
-22
assets-list.component.ts
...ssets-used/checkPlan/assets-list/assets-list.component.ts
+5
-3
check-add.component.html
.../assets-used/checkPlan/check-add/check-add.component.html
+25
-6
check-plan.component.html
...es/assets/assets-used/checkPlan/check-plan.component.html
+3
-3
check-plan.component.ts
...utes/assets/assets-used/checkPlan/check-plan.component.ts
+3
-2
api.service.ts
src/app/service/layout/service/api.service.ts
+5
-0
logo.jpg
src/assets/logo.jpg
+0
-0
global.scss
src/global.scss
+1
-6
No files found.
config.xml
View file @
9a546064
...
...
@@ -3,7 +3,7 @@
<name>
MyApp
</name>
<description>
An awesome Ionic/Cordova app.
</description>
<author
email=
"hi@ionicframework.com"
href=
"http://ionicframework.com/"
>
Ionic Framework Team
</author>
<content
original-src=
"index.html"
src=
"http://192.168.19.225:8100
"
/>
<content
src=
"index.html
"
/>
<access
origin=
"*"
/>
<allow-intent
href=
"http://*/*"
/>
<allow-intent
href=
"https://*/*"
/>
...
...
proxy.config.json
View file @
9a546064
{
"/asset/*"
:
{
"target"
:
"http://
localhost:8081
"
,
"target"
:
"http://
192.168.19.171:8082
"
,
"secure"
:
false
,
"logLevel"
:
"debug"
,
"changeOrigin"
:
true
...
...
src/app/layout/default/assets/assets.component.ts
View file @
9a546064
...
...
@@ -173,12 +173,12 @@ export class AssetsComponent implements OnInit {
icon
:
"<i class='iconfont icon-discardedDisposal'></i>"
,
text
:
"资产处置"
,
link
:
"/admin/assets-used/discardedDisposal"
},
{
icon
:
"<i class='iconfont icon-assetsUseRecord'></i>"
,
text
:
"资产使用记录"
,
link
:
"/admin/assets-used/assetsUseRecord"
}
// {
// icon: "<i class='iconfont icon-assetsUseRecord'></i>",
// text: "资产使用记录",
// link: "/admin/assets-used/assetsUseRecord"
// }
]
},
{
...
...
src/app/layout/default/check/check.component.html
View file @
9a546064
...
...
@@ -9,6 +9,6 @@
<div
(
click
)="
onExpend
(
item
)"
>
{{item.expend?'更多':'收起'}}
</div>
</Flex>
</div>
<Grid
class=
"primary"
[
activeStyle
]="
true
"
[
hasLine
]="
false
"
[
data
]="
item
.
children
"
(
onClick
)="
click
($
event
)"
></Grid>
<Grid
[
activeStyle
]="
true
"
[
hasLine
]="
false
"
[
data
]="
item
.
children
"
(
onClick
)="
click
($
event
)"
></Grid>
</ng-container>
</div>
\ No newline at end of file
src/app/layout/default/user/user.component.html
View file @
9a546064
...
...
@@ -30,7 +30,7 @@
</List>
<WhiteSpace
size=
'md'
></WhiteSpace>
<WingBlank
[
size
]="'
lg
'"
>
<div
Button
[
type
]="'
primary
'"
>
退出
</div>
<div
Button
[
type
]="'
primary
'"
(
click
)="
logout
()"
>
退出
</div>
</WingBlank>
</div>
</div>
\ No newline at end of file
src/app/layout/default/user/user.component.ts
View file @
9a546064
...
...
@@ -15,4 +15,7 @@ export class UserComponent implements OnInit {
jumpPassword
()
{
this
.
router
.
navigateByUrl
(
"/admin/user/password"
);
}
logout
()
{
this
.
router
.
navigateByUrl
(
"/passport/login"
);
}
}
src/app/layout/passport/passport.component.html
View file @
9a546064
...
...
@@ -3,7 +3,7 @@
<div
class=
"top"
>
<div
class=
"head"
>
<p>
<img
src=
"./assets/logo.
jp
g"
alt=
""
>
<img
src=
"./assets/logo.
pn
g"
alt=
""
>
</p>
<span
class=
"title"
>
路桥资产管理系统
</span>
</div>
...
...
src/app/layout/passport/passport.component.less
View file @
9a546064
...
...
@@ -2,7 +2,5 @@
text-align: center;
font-size: 20px;
padding: 50px 0;
img{
width:263px;
}
}
src/app/routes/assets/assets-used/checkPlan/assets-list/assets-list.component.html
View file @
9a546064
...
...
@@ -146,30 +146,18 @@
<ListItem
*
ngFor=
"let row of table.rows"
multipleLine
>
<div
[
ngClass
]="{'
list-content
'
:
!
row
.
showAll
}"
>
<p>
附件名称:{{row.accessoryName}}
</p>
<p>
帐面数量:{{row.count}}
</p>
<p>
净值:{{row.assetNetValue}}
</p>
<p>
计量单位:{{row.unit}}
</p>
<p>
管理单位:{{row.company? row.company.id:""}}
</p>
<p>
规格型号:{{row.modelNum}}
</p>
<p>
生产厂家:{{row.madeFirms}}
</p>
<p>
资产状态:{{row.assetState}}
</p>
<p>
产权单位:{{row.belongUnit? row.belongUnit.id:""}}
</p>
<p>
生产能力单位:{{row.productivityUnit}}
</p>
<p>
使用单位:{{row.useUnit? row.useUnit.id:""}}
</p>
<p>
资产名称:{{row.name}}
</p>
<p>
生产能力:{{row.productivity}}
</p>
<p>
保管人:{{row.preserver? row.preserver.id:""}}
</p>
<p>
折旧年限:{{row.depreciableLife}}
</p>
<p>
存放地:{{row.storage}}
</p>
<p>
资产编号:{{row.num}}
</p>
<p>
车架号:{{row.vin}}
</p>
<p>
不含税_单价:{{row.noTaxPrice}}
</p>
<p>
设备技术状况:{{row.technologySta}}
</p>
<p>
购入日期:{{row.buyDate}}
</p>
<p>
实盘数量:{{row.actualCount}}
</p>
<p>
资产编号:{{row.asset.num}}
</p>
<p>
规格型号:{{row.modelNum}}
</p>
<p>
资产分类:{{row.assetClass}}
</p>
<p>
原值:{{row.noTaxPrice}}
</p>
<p>
净值:{{row.assetNetValue}}
</p>
<p>
产权单位:{{row.belongUnit}}
</p>
<p>
管理单位:{{row.company}}
</p>
<p>
使用单位:{{row.useUnit}}
</p>
</div>
<div
Button
[
type
]="'
primary
'"
(
click
)="
goDetail
(
row
.
id
)"
[
inline
]="
true
"
class=
"list-detail"
[
size
]="'
small
'"
>
下一步
<div
Button
[
type
]="'
primary
'"
(
click
)="
goDetail
(
row
.
asset
.
id
)"
[
inline
]="
true
"
class=
"list-detail"
[
size
]="'
small
'"
>
下一步
</div>
<div
(
click
)="
row
.
showAll=
!row.showAll"
class=
"list-more am-list-arrow"
[
ngClass
]="
row
.
showAll
?'
am-list-arrow-vertical-up
'
:
'
am-list-arrow-vertical
'"
></div>
...
...
src/app/routes/assets/assets-used/checkPlan/assets-list/assets-list.component.ts
View file @
9a546064
...
...
@@ -45,8 +45,10 @@ export class AssetsListComponent implements OnInit {
private
router
:
Router
,
private
activatedRoute
:
ActivatedRoute
,
private
api
:
APIService
)
{}
)
{
this
.
id
=
activatedRoute
.
snapshot
.
queryParams
[
"id"
];
}
id
;
renderFooter
:
Function
;
renderHeader
:
Function
;
search
:
any
=
{};
...
...
@@ -122,7 +124,7 @@ export class AssetsListComponent implements OnInit {
this
.
state
.
show
=
false
;
}
loadData
(
search
)
{
this
.
api
.
get
FixedAssetsList
(
search
).
subscribe
(
data
=>
{
this
.
api
.
get
Assets
(
search
,
this
.
id
).
subscribe
(
data
=>
{
this
.
table
=
data
;
});
}
...
...
src/app/routes/assets/assets-used/checkPlan/check-add/check-add.component.html
View file @
9a546064
<form
[
formGroup
]="
registerForm
"
(
ngSubmit
)="
onSubmit
()"
>
<
<<<<<<
HEAD
<
input
type=
"hidden"
formControlName=
"id"
[
ngModel
]="
detail
.
id
"
>
<List
[
renderHeader
]=(
renderHeader
)
>
<ListItem
[
extra
]="
detail
.
modelNum
"
>
盘点单号
</ListItem>
...
...
@@ -20,9 +20,15 @@
<font
color=
"red"
>
*
</font>
盘点状态
</app-form-select>
<!-- <InputItem [placeholder]="'盘点单号'" [value]="detail.modelNum" [disabled]="disabled" [(ngModel)]="detail.modelNum">
=======
<List [renderHeader]=(renderHeader)>
<InputItem [placeholder]="'盘点单号'" [error]="isError" [focus]="onFocus" [value]="invoicesNum" [clear]="true"
formControlName="invoicesNum">
<font color="red">*</font>
>>>>>>> b6e79db9bbb73e21767c2641d100bf0d05551ef2
盘点单号
</InputItem>
-->
<
!-- <
InputItem [placeholder]="'请输入事项名称'" [error]="isError" [focus]="onFocus" [value]="name" [clear]="true"
</InputItem>
<InputItem [placeholder]="'请输入事项名称'" [error]="isError" [focus]="onFocus" [value]="name" [clear]="true"
formControlName="name">
<font color="red">*</font>
事项名称
...
...
@@ -41,7 +47,7 @@
</app-form-date>
<app-form-select [options]="checkStaType" formControlName="checkSta">
<font color="red">*</font>盘点状态
</app-form-select>
-->
</app-form-select>
...
...
@@ -85,10 +91,22 @@
</div>
</ListItem>
</List>
</form>
<div
class=
"error"
[
innerHTML
]="
msg
"
>
</div>
</form>
<List
[
renderHeader
]=(
renderHeader2
)
>
<ListItem
[
extra
]="
detail
.
asset
.
num
"
>
资产编号
</ListItem>
<ListItem
[
extra
]="
detail
.
asset
.
name
"
>
资产名称
</ListItem>
<ListItem
[
extra
]="
detail
.
modelNum
"
>
规格型号
</ListItem>
<ListItem
[
extra
]="
detail
.
madeFirms
"
>
生产厂家
</ListItem>
<ListItem
[
extra
]="
detail
.
taxPrice
"
>
账面原值
</ListItem>
<ListItem
[
extra
]="
detail
.
addDepreciation
"
>
累计折旧
</ListItem>
<ListItem
[
extra
]="
detail
.
qualitySta
"
>
品质状况
</ListItem>
<ListItem
[
extra
]="
detail
.
checkResult
"
>
盘点结果
</ListItem>
<ListItem
[
extra
]="
detail
.
belongUnit
.
id
"
>
归属单位
</ListItem>
<ListItem
[
extra
]="
detail
.
projectTeam
.
id
"
>
项目组
</ListItem>
<ListItem
[
extra
]="
detail
.
assetClass
.
id
"
>
资产分类
</ListItem>
</List>
\ No newline at end of file
src/app/routes/assets/assets-used/checkPlan/check-plan.component.html
View file @
9a546064
...
...
@@ -20,10 +20,10 @@
</ListItem>
<ListItem>
<a
Button
[
routerLink
]="['../
checkPlanAdd
','
fb80bc516677459ab2b43d709e335cb7
'
]"
[
type
]="'
primary
'"
style=
"margin-right: 2.5px;"
[
size
]="'
small
'"
<!-- <a Button [routerLink]="['../checkPlanAdd',222
]" [type]="'primary'" style="margin-right: 2.5px;" [size]="'small'"
[inline]="true">
添加
</a>
</a>
-->
<a
Button
[
type
]="'
primary
'"
[
size
]="'
small
'"
[
inline
]="
true
"
(
onClick
)="
doSearch
(
search
)"
>
提交
</a>
...
...
@@ -47,7 +47,7 @@
<p>
开始时间:{{row.beginDate}}
</p>
<p>
事项名称:{{row.name}}
</p>
</div>
<div
Button
[
type
]="'
primary
'"
(
click
)="
goAssetsList
()"
[
inline
]="
true
"
class=
"list-detail"
[
size
]="'
small
'"
>
下一步
<div
Button
[
type
]="'
primary
'"
(
click
)="
goAssetsList
(
row
.
id
)"
[
inline
]="
true
"
class=
"list-detail"
[
size
]="'
small
'"
>
下一步
</div>
<div
(
click
)="
row
.
showAll=
!row.showAll"
class=
"list-more am-list-arrow"
[
ngClass
]="
row
.
showAll
?'
am-list-arrow-vertical-up
'
:
'
am-list-arrow-vertical
'"
></div>
...
...
src/app/routes/assets/assets-used/checkPlan/check-plan.component.ts
View file @
9a546064
...
...
@@ -99,9 +99,10 @@ export class CheckPlanComponent implements OnInit {
onReset
()
{
this
.
search
=
{};
}
goAssetsList
()
{
goAssetsList
(
id
)
{
this
.
router
.
navigate
([
"../assetsList"
],
{
relativeTo
:
this
.
activatedRoute
relativeTo
:
this
.
activatedRoute
,
queryParams
:
{
id
:
id
}
});
}
showDate
(
key
:
string
)
{
...
...
src/app/service/layout/service/api.service.ts
View file @
9a546064
...
...
@@ -62,6 +62,8 @@ const CheckTask = "asset/a/asset/checkPlan/view/checkPlanList/";
const
CheckDetail
=
"asset/a/asset/checkPlan/view/checkInfo/"
;
const
CheckSave
=
"asset/a/asset/checkPlan/save/result"
;
const
Upload
=
"asset/a/sys/file/webupload/upload"
;
const
assetsUrl
=
"asset/a/asset/checkPlan/infoData"
;
@
Injectable
({
providedIn
:
"root"
})
...
...
@@ -265,4 +267,7 @@ export class APIService {
getConsumableReceiveList
(
param
):
Observable
<
any
>
{
return
this
.
basePost
(
ConsumableReceive
,
param
);
}
getAssets
(
param
,
id
)
{
return
this
.
basePost
(
assetsUrl
+
"/?id="
+
id
,
param
);
}
}
src/assets/logo.jpg
deleted
100644 → 0
View file @
a5b655ff
42.5 KB
src/global.scss
View file @
9a546064
...
...
@@ -36,18 +36,13 @@
font-size
:
20px
;
display
:
block
;
height
:
40px
;
background
:
#
616d75
;
background
:
#
108ee9
;
display
:
flex
;
align-items
:
center
;
justify-content
:
center
;
border-radius
:
100%
;
color
:
#fff
;
}
.primary
{
.
am-grid
.
am-grid-item-content
.
iconfont
:
:
before
{
background
:
#108ee9
;
}
}
.am-list-content
{
>
div
{
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ment